OverviewLongview Campground is situated on Perry Lake in the lush Kansas forest, offering peaceful, family-oriented camping.Natural Features:Perry Lake Dam was completed in 1966 to help with flood control for the Missouri and Mississippi Rivers. Today, the lake boasts 160 miles of shoreline and 11,150 surface acres of water, creating countless recreational activities for visitors, and earning it the nickname "paradise on the plains." Recreation:Perry lake has a reputation for being one of the best sailing lakes in the region; however, boaters of all types will enjoy the many opportunities offered here, whether it's sailing, power boating or canoeing. Facilities:Longview Campground is known as a quiet, family-oriented destination. Non-electric campsites are located along the shoreline, offering excellent views of the lake and the sunset each night. Activities and Amenities

Getting There:GPS Info. (Latitude, Longitude):39.18472, -95.44444 39°11'5"N, 95°26'40"W From Perry, Kansas, go 8 miles north on Ferguson road, then 2 miles west on 86th street and follow signs to the campground.
